A magnifying glass with light is a handheld optical tool designed to enlarge small objects or text while providing built-in illumination for better visibility. It combines a traditional magnifying lens with a small light source, usually LED lights, to make it easier to see fine details in low-light or dim environments. This tool is widely used for reading small print, inspecting objects, crafting, repair work, and scientific observation.
Physical Structure
A magnifying glass with light typically consists of three main components:
1. Magnifying Lens
The lens is the most important part of the device. It is usually made from optical glass or high-quality acrylic plastic and is designed to enlarge objects placed beneath it. The magnification strength can vary, commonly ranging from 2× to 10× or higher, depending on the design. The lens is often round but can also be rectangular in some models.
2. Built-in Lighting System
The integrated lighting system surrounds or sits near the lens. Most modern magnifying glasses use energy-efficient LED lights because they provide bright illumination while using little power. The light helps remove shadows and highlights small details that might otherwise be difficult to see.
3. Handle or Frame
The magnifying glass usually has a comfortable handle or grip that allows the user to hold it steadily. Some models have ergonomic handles made of rubber or plastic to prevent slipping. In certain designs, the magnifier may also include a folding handle or stand so it can rest on a table for hands-free use.
Types of Magnifying Glass with Light
There are several types available depending on their use:
Handheld Magnifier – The most common type, held in the hand for reading or inspection.
Stand Magnifier – Designed to sit on a surface for hands-free viewing.
Headband Magnifier – Worn on the head for precision tasks like electronics repair.
Desk Lamp Magnifier – A larger magnifier attached to an adjustable lamp arm.
Common Uses
Magnifying glasses with light are helpful in many everyday and professional activities, including:
Reading small print in books, newspapers, or labels
Inspecting jewelry, coins, stamps, and collectibles
Performing precision repair work such as electronics or watch repair
Assisting people with low vision or aging eyesight
Crafting tasks like sewing, embroidery, and model building
Educational activities in science and observation

Power Source
The lighting system usually operates using small batteries (AA, AAA, or button cells) or rechargeable batteries. Some modern models can also be charged using a USB cable.
Maintenance and Care
To keep a magnifying glass with light in good condition:
Clean the lens regularly with a soft cloth to remove dust and fingerprints
Replace or recharge batteries when the light becomes dim
Store it in a protective case or dry place to prevent scratches on the lens
